Biological Background
This antibody enables you to examine P2RX5 (P2X5) with a direct, biology-first readout. P2RX5 is a membrane-embedded regulator of ionic or osmotic balance in cells. Focus on trends across conditions rather than single-point snapshots.
In some datasets and protocols, it is referenced by the gene symbol P2X5.
Use in the Laboratory
Modulators that affect trafficking, phosphorylation, or ligand binding can change apparent distribution and signal intensity. Pair measurements with orthogonal readouts when interpretation is sensitive to context. Neural differentiation and synaptic organization projects may include this target as a contextual readout.
Depending on the model, researchers may ask whether signal shifts reflect altered abundance, compartment changes, or remodeling of associated complexes.
To keep datasets interpretable, labs often document:
- relative abundance across engineered constructs
- patterns consistent with apical or basolateral sorting
- stimulus-dependent trafficking and turnover
- surface versus intracellular pool distribution
